About Morocco
Situated in the Maghreb region of North Africa, Morocco is known for large swathes of desert, mountainous regions and coastlines on both the Atlantic and the Mediterranean oceans.
In addition to a mixed landscape, Morocco is also a unique and diverse culture created by a combination of Arab, Berber (a race indigenous to the Nile Valley), Sub-Saharan African and European influences.
While the predominant religion for the population of 33,250,000 people is Islam, the official languages of Morocco are Berber and Arabic. Moroccan Aravic (Darija) and French are also widely spoken throughout the country.
As for living in the area, Morocco was ranked the number one African Country by the quality-of-life index, thanks in part to an economy boost helped along by high tourism growth.
